Can an employer withdraw an offer of employment once made?

Employment
Insights
An offer of employment can be withdrawn at any time before it has been accepted by the employee without having to give notice or make a payment in lieu of notice.

Can fathers claim for psychiatric injury following stillbirth?

Medical negligence
Insights
A “secondary victim” is someone who suffers psychiatric injury solely as a result of witnessing the injury or risk of harm to another person. Fathers and birth partners may in some circumstances fall into the category of “secondary victim”.
